Since the debut release
of "The Vision" in 1994, Cosmicity has sold almost 6000 albums, not including
CD singles or compilations.
At Synthcon
2001 in Hollywood, Cosmicity was awarded "Synthpop Artist of the Year"
at the American Synthpop Awards ceremony.
Cosmicity was also the
first ever recipient of two out of four possible American Synthpop Awards in
2000. One for the song "Self Involved" in the category of Best Single and one
for the song "Too Far Gone (Extremely No Good Mix)" in the category of best
12" remix.
Cosmicity
has performed dozens of live shows in major cities accross North America including
New York, Los Angeles, Philadelphia, Salt Lake City, Dallas, Albuquerque, Chicago,
Detroit, Washington DC, Baltimore, Richmond, Pittsburgh, Toronto, and even a
show in Mexico City, Mexico. (Learn more at the live
page.)
Cosmicity has been on
over 30 electronic music compilations, along-side major artists such as Information
Society, Red Flag, Alphaville, White Town, Anything Box and many more. (See
list on the bottom of the albums page.)
Since
1994, Cosmicity has released 10 albums/EPs and 6CD singles for a total of 16
releases. (See complete list at the bottom of the order
page.)
